Life time of a power bank

Power banks are related with 2 various kinds of lifetimes.

Charge discharge cycles: Any rechargeable battery will ultimately break due to charge-discharge cycles. Generally, a battery's lifetime is revealed in terms of the variety of charge-discharge cycles it can withstand prior to its efficiency breaks down to a certain degree. Some of the cheaper power banks might just last 500 or two charge discharge cycles, while the more expensive ones will last many more.

Self-discharge time: All battery cells, whether rechargeable or primary, have some self-discharge time. A percentage of electrical power is required to keep rechargeable batteries with their own control circuitry alive nowadays. As a result, a battery can only be charged for a restricted quantity of time.

A decent power bank can hold a charge for approximately 6 months with just a tiny loss of charge, whereas a lower-quality power bank might only last around a month. These stats are for space temperature; nevertheless, keeping them beyond these temperature levels lowers their efficiency significantly.

Power banks are more than merely batteries:

they utilize complex electrical circuitry to charge and then charge additional gadgets.

To guarantee that the level of charge in the battery is known so that they are not overcharged, that they are charged at the right rate, and that the charging of the portable devices is managed, specially developed incorporated circuits and modules offer all of the intelligence required.

When it comes to how a works, it is merely a battery into which electricity is generally sent from a primary powered USB charger. This is conserved and after that sent out to the gadget under charge as needed.

To enable this function, the power bank consists of not simply a battery, but also intricate electronics that manage all of these activities.

It is simple to understand how a power bank works. The circuit block diagram of a power bank might be of interest to you as well. Input port, charging circuit, battery, releasing circuit, output port, and indications are all part of a power bank.

The power bank is charged through the input connector. The charging circuit is intended to charge the power bank through a battery charger. This manages the voltage and present provided to the battery. The energy storage aspect is the battery. The draining circuit works really identically to the charging circuit.

It will manage the amount of existing drawn from the battery. A high discharge current will minimize battery life. The output port is used to connect gadgets and gadgets that will be charged by the power bank. Indicators are merely visual tracking elements that have been included.

What is a power bank's true output capacity?

we presume the capacity mentioned by the manufacturer is that of the power bank itself, whereas in reality it shows the capability of the internal battery housed in the power bank.

And this is the main issue that many clients have when buying a power bank without considering the real capability they would have at their disposal.

You must know that when you link a smartphone to the power bank's USB connection, it gets charged at 5V, however the power bank battery runs at 3.6-3.7 V.

This indicates that the internal circuit of the power bank must raise this voltage to the one needed by the USB port, lowering the power bank capacity available to charge our gadgets.

Why is my portable battery charger blinking?

Quick flashing recommends an issue with the battery pack or a weak connection between the battery and charger. Eliminate the battery from the charger and wipe the metal contact terminals with a dry fabric or cotton swap. If the flashing continues, it is possible that the battery has to be changed.

This problem may be triggered by a number of factors. The following are some probable causes and how to repair them:

1. Examine whether or not the power cord is fully inserted.

It is possible that you did not properly put the power adapter into the charging port, leading to a malfunctioning connection. Take a look at the plug to make sure that it fits securely into the socket.

2. Try out a various power cable television when charging.

If the connections are tight and the power bank is still not charging, the power cord might be defective. Some power cords are of bad quality, which has a direct effect on charging rate.

3. Charge the power bank using a wall outlet rather than a laptop USB port.

Guarantee that you are charging the power bank from a mains power outlet rather than a computer, as the output existing from a computer system USB connection is generally around 0.5 A, which is inadequate to charge the power bank.
